When asked which of the candidates would do a better job as president handling military personnel issues, such as pay and benefits, McCain leads Obama 73% to 18%.
When asked which of the candidates would do a better job as president handling Defense Department issues, such as weapons purchases, the size of the armed forces and national security strategy, McCain leads Obama 77% to 15%.
